What is the solution to the equation X/2- 4 = 6? x = 1 x = 5 x = 10 x = 20

[ Answer ]

\boxed{\bold{X \ = \ 20}}

[ Explanation ]

  • Solve: X ÷ 2 - 4 = 6

--------------------------

  • Rewrite Equation

\frac{X}{2} - 4 = 6

  • Add 4 To Both Sides

\frac{X}{2} - 4 + 4 = 6 + 4

  • Simplify

\frac{X}{2} = 10

  • Multiply Both Sides By 2

\frac{2x}{2} = 10 · 2

  • Simplify

X = 20
